3D printing is a phrase coined with the media and is commonly used to consult with all sorts of additive manufacturing. On the other hand, strictly speaking 3D printing is described as “…fabrication of objects throughout the deposition of a material utilizing a print head, nozzle or other printer technologies”.

Customization – On the list of prized details of additive manufacturing systems is the flexibility for mass customization. Since 3D printed elements are usually manufactured one after the other, this gives designers and corporations the ability to alter, modify, or personalize their products and solutions since they see fit.

The printing approach transpires within a chamber which contains an atmosphere of inert gasoline. Each layer on the section is fused by selectively melting the powder using a substantial-driven ytterbium fiber laser. The laser beam is directed in each the X and Y directions with two high frequency scanning mirrors.

Electron beam melting is the same additive manufacturing strategy that uses an electron beam as the heat resource. Even so, EBM commonly provides a extra economical Construct price as a consequence of its significant-Electricity density and scanning strategy.
